NATIONAL THINK TANKS
These think tanks specialize in research and advocacy related to national education issues.

The Acton Institute
The Acton Institute is an ecumenical think-tank dedicated to the study of free-market economics informed by religious faith and moral absolutes.

American Enterprise Institute
The American Enterprise Institute for Public Policy Research is a private, nonpartisan, not-for-profit institution dedicated to research and education on issues of government, politics, economics, and social welfare.

American Legislative Exchange Council
The American Legislative Exchange Council is a non-profit educational membership organization for state lawmakers.

Brookings Institution
The Brookings Institution is a nonprofit public policy organization based in Washington, DC. Our mission is to conduct high-quality, independent research and, based on that research, to provide innovative, practical recommendations.

Cato Institute
Promotes public policy based on individual liberty, limited government, free markets, and peaceful international relations.

Claremont Institute
The mission of the Claremont Institute is to restore the principles of the American Founding to their rightful, preeminent authority in our national life. The Claremont Institute is a nonprofit organization.

Competitive Enterprise Institute
A non-profit public policy organization dedicated to the principles of free enterprise and limited government.

Democratic Leadership Council
Washington has more than enough organizations to echo existing orthodoxies or churn out talking points on every issue. Our goal is different -- to be a reform think tank that can make ideas happen.

Democrats for Education Reform
Democrats for Education Reform aims to return the Democratic Party to its rightful place as a champion of children, first and foremost, in America's public education systems. We support leaders in our party who have the courage to challenge a failing status quo and who believe that the severity of our nation's educational crisis demands that we tackle this problem using every possible tool at our disposal.

Discovery Institute
Discovery Institute's mission is to make a positive vision of the future practical. The Institute discovers and promotes ideas in the common sense tradition of representative government, the free market and individual liberty.

Education Sector
Education Sector is an independent think tank that challenges conventional thinking in education policy. We are a nonprofit, nonpartisan organization committed to achieving measurable impact in education policy, both by improving existing reform initiatives and by developing new, innovative solutions to our nation's most pressing education problems.

FreedomWorks
FreedomWorks recruits, educates, trains and mobilizes hundreds of thousands of volunteer activists to fight for less government, lower taxes, and more freedom.

Free Congress Foundation
Free Congress Foundation is politically and culturally conservative. Most think tanks talk about tax rates or the environment or welfare policy and occasionally we do also. But our main focus is on the Culture War.

Heritage Foundation
To formulate and promote conservative public policies based on the principles of free enterprise, limited government, individual freedom, traditional American values, and a strong national defense.

Hoover Institution
Hoover Institution is a think tank on the campus of Stanford University, dedicated to research in domestic policy and international affairs.

Hudson Institute
Hudson Institute is a non-partisan policy research organization dedicated to innovative research and analysis that promotes global security, prosperity, and freedom.

The Independent Institute
A nonprofit, scholarly research and educational organization which sponsors comprehensive studies on political economy.

The Institute for Policy Innovation
Advocating lower taxes, fewer regulations, and a smaller, less-intrusive government.

Ludwig von Mises Institute
The Ludwig von Mises Institute is the research and educational center of classical liberalism and the Austrian School of economics.

Manhattan Institute for Policy Research
For over 30 years, the Manhattan Institute has been an important force in shaping American political culture and developing ideas that foster economic choice and individual responsibility.

National Bureau of Economic Research
Founded in 1920, the National Bureau of Economic Research is a private, nonprofit, nonpartisan research organization dedicated to promoting a greater understanding of how the economy works.

National Center for Policy Analysis
The National Center for Policy Analysis (NCPA) is a nonprofit, nonpartisan public policy research organization, established in 1983. The NCPA's goal is to develop and promote private alternatives to government regulation and control, solving problems by relying on the strength of the competitive, entrepreneurial private sector.

National Conference of State Legislatures
Offers a variety of services to help lawmakers tailor policies that will work for their states and their constituents.

New America Foundation
The New America Foundation is a nonprofit, nonpartisan public policy institute that invests in new thinkers and new ideas to address the next generation of challenges facing the United States.

Northwest Regional Educational Laboratory
NWREL is a private nonprofit working closely with schools, districts, and other agencies to develop creative and practical solutions to important educational challenges.

Progressive Policy Institute
PPI's mission is to define and promote a new progressive politics for America in the 21st century. Through its research, policies, and perspectives, the Institute is fashioning a new governing philosophy and an agenda for public innovation geared to the Information Age.

RAND Corporation
RAND Corporation is the original non-profit think tank helping to improve policy and decision making through objective research and analysis.

Reason Foundation
A public policy think tank promoting choice, competition, and a dynamic market economy as the foundation for human dignity and progress.

Thomas B. Fordham Institute
The Thomas B. Fordham Institute is a non-profit think tank dedicated to advancing educational excellence.

The Urban Institute
An institute investigating and analysing US social and economic problems and issues.
